Understanding LCD Displays: Types, Advantages, and Applications

LCD stands for Liquid Crystal Display. It is a type of flat-panel display that uses liquid crystals to create images on the screen. LCD displays are commonly used in a wide range of devices, including TVs, computer monitors, smartphones, and watches.

How does an LCD work?
An LCD works by using a layer of liquid crystals to block or allow light to pass through a matrix of pixels. The liquid crystals are electrically controlled to adjust the amount of light that passes through each pixel, creating the images on the screen.

What are the advantages of LCDs over other display technologies?
LCDs have several advantages over other display technologies, including:

1. Thin and lightweight: LCDs are much thinner and lighter than traditional CRT displays.
2. Low power consumption: LCDs use less power than CRT displays, making them more energy-efficient.
3. High resolution: LCDs can offer high resolutions and sharp images.
4. Wide viewing angle: LCDs can be viewed from a wide angle without any loss of image quality.
5. Cost-effective: LCDs are generally less expensive to produce than other display technologies.

What are some common applications of LCDs?
LCDs are commonly used in a wide range of applications, including:

1. TVs and computer monitors
2. Smartphones and tablets
3. Watches and other wearables
4. Automotive displays
5. Medical displays
6. Industrial displays
7. Aerospace displays
